Taoiseach hails 'constructive' North South Ministerial Committee meeting

Ministers from both sides of the Irish border have hailed the latest round of Brexit discussions as their best yet.

The UK's forthcoming EU departure topped the agenda at a meeting of the North South Ministerial Committee (NSMC) where Foreign Minister Charlie Flanagan joined Stormont's First Minister Arlene Foster and Deputy First Minister Martin McGuinness in Armagh this afternoon.
